Of the 15 students who earned an associate's degree in Ophthalmic & Optometric Support Services from Inter American University of Puerto Rico - Ponce in 2020-2021, 27% were men and 73% were women.
The majority of the associate's degree graduates for this major are Hispanic or Latino. In the most recent graduating class for which data is available, 100% of grads fell into this category.
